20120204537 | Adaptive diesel particulate filter regeneration control and method - An after-treatment device that includes a diesel particulate filter (DPF) requiring periodic regeneration includes a sensor providing a signal indicative of a soot accumulation and at least one device providing an operating parameter indicative of a work mode of the machine. A controller determines a soot loading of the DPF based least partially on the soot signal, and a readiness level based on the operating parameter. A soot level trigger is determined based on a time period since a regeneration was completed and the readiness level, and a debounce time period is determined based on the soot loading and the readiness level. The controller is configured to initiate a regeneration event of the DPF when the debounce time period has expired while the soot loading exceeds the soot level trigger. | 08-16-2012 |

20140238233 | FLAME DETECTION SYSTEM FOR PARTICULATE FILTER REGENERATION - A flame detection system is disclosed. The system may have a flame chamber and a filter, wherein the filter includes filter media configured to collect matter from an engine exhaust. Additionally, the filter may be disposed downstream of the flame chamber. An ignition device may be disposed in the flame chamber and may be configured to ignite a flame in the flame chamber to regenerate the filter. A sensor may be disposed proximate the ignition device, and may be configured to sense a change in electrical conductivity that is indicative of a presence of the flame in the flame chamber. | 08-28-2014 |

20080271450 | Exhaust gas recirculation system - A power system including an exhaust producing engine, an exhaust system and an exhaust gas recirculation (EGR) system is provided. The EGR system may include an EGR flowpath and an air intake system. The EGR system may also include an EGR valve configured to regulate the flow of exhaust gases through the EGR flowpath. The power system may also include a monitoring system configured to monitor operating parameters of at least two components of the EGR system. The power system may also include a controller configured to determine, based on the monitored operating parameters, a maximum flowrate value for each of the components. Each of the maximum flowrate values may represent the maximum EGR flowrate for that component. The controller may be configured to control the EGR valve, based on the maximum flowrate values, to result in an EGR flowrate no greater than the lowest of the maximum flowrate values. | 11-06-2008 |

20150260069 | Fluid Delivery System and Method - A fluid delivery system includes a reservoir, a pump, an injector, and a pressure regulator. The reservoir encloses a fluid and includes a reservoir body forming a reservoir volume that encloses the fluid. The reservoir includes a draw conduit and a return conduit. The pump has an inlet connected to the draw conduit and provides fluid at the operating pressure and at a desired flow to a pressure line that is fluidly connected to an outlet of the pump. The injector selectively opens to allow an injected fluid flow to pass therethrough. The return orifice fluidly connects the pressure line with the return conduit, and the pressure regulator provides a regulated fluid flow to the fluid reservoir. During operation, the desired fluid flow is equal to a sum of the injected fluid flow, the return fluid flow and the regulated fluid flow. | 09-17-2015 |

20130278215 | Case For Portable Electronic Device With Integral Detachable Power Converter For Battery Charging - An auxiliary device case for portable electronic devices provides physical protection from abrasion and mishandling. The device case includes an integral power converter module with small form factor. The power converter module is provided to power and recharge the internal batteries of the portable electronic device, and is stored within the case when not in use. The power converter module is removable from the case for connection to a wall power receptacle and is connected to the case by means of a retractable cord. The power converter module may include retractable blades and a hinged cord attachment to minimize the overall volume when stored within the case. | 10-24-2013 |

20080254171 | Spreadable fruit preparation having a low content of solids and methods of manufacture - A spreadable fruit preparation having a low content of soluble solids contains fruit, sugar, citric acid, and pectin. The percent by weight of total soluble solids of the spreadable fruit preparation is less than 50 percent, the sugar content of one mL of the spreadable fruit preparation is less than about 0.634 grams of sugar per mL of the spreadable fruit preparation, and the caloric content is less than about 2.536 kilocalories per mL of the spreadable fruit preparation. | 10-16-2008 |
